MOT History

10 pass 3 fail
Pass 16 Dec 2016 76,983 miles
Pass 10 Dec 2015 70,740 miles

Windscreen has damage to an area less than a 40mm circle outside zone 'A' (8.3.1d)

Pass 11 Feb 2015 65,611 miles
Pass 16 Jan 2014 58,338 miles

Nearside Windscreen has damage to an area less than a 40mm circle outside zone 'A' (8.3.1d)

Fail 7 Jan 2014 58,338 miles

Nearside Headlamp insecure (1.7.3)

Pass 31 Oct 2012 54,868 miles

N/S/F headlamp loose

Front wipers blades smearing

Nearside Front brake disc worn, pitted or scored, but not seriously weakened (3.5.1i)

Offside Front brake disc worn, pitted or scored, but not seriously weakened (3.5.1i)

Windscreen has damage to an area less than a 40mm circle outside zone 'A' (8.3.1d)

Fail 29 Oct 2012 54,868 miles

Nearside Front Tyre has a bulge, caused by separation or partial failure of its structure (4.1.D.1b)

Nearside Rear Direction indicators incorrect colour (1.4.A.2f)

Offside Rear Direction indicators incorrect colour (1.4.A.2f)

Front wipers blades smearing

N/S/F headlamp loose

Nearside Front brake disc worn, pitted or scored, but not seriously weakened (3.5.1i)

Offside Front brake disc worn, pitted or scored, but not seriously weakened (3.5.1i)

Windscreen has damage to an area less than a 40mm circle outside zone 'A' (8.3.1d)

Pass 25 Aug 2011 49,385 miles

rear discs corroded

Fail 26 Jul 2010 46,994 miles

Nearside Headlamp aim aimed so that it dazzles other road users (1.8.A.1a)

Offside Rear Shock absorber has a serious fluid leak (2.7.3)

Rear Shock absorber has a slightly reduced damping effect (2.7.5)

nearside & offside front brake discs slightly pitted

Pass 26 Jul 2010 46,994 miles

Rear Shock absorber has a slightly reduced damping effect (2.7.5)

nearside & offside front brake discs slightly pitted

Pass 28 Jul 2009 40,969 miles

Front brake disc slightly pitted (3.5.1h)

Pass 3 Sep 2008 37,115 miles
Pass 25 Oct 2006 29,429 miles

AE53 PXN is a 2003 Seat Leon in Blue with a 1,598c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 13 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 76.9%.

Across all 2003 Seat Leon models, the average MOT pass rate is 71.5% with a typical mileage of 80,078 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.

The most common reason a Seat Leon f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 67,909 recorded failures. If you're considering buying AE53 PXN,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Seat Leon typically stays on UK roads for around 26 years. At 23 years old, this Seat Leon is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
